Demanded to Surrender Domains, Unicoin Countersues Uniswap Labs - Requests Court to Cancel ‘UNI’ Trademark

A trademark dispute between two crypto entities has officially landed in the U.S. District Court for the Southern District of New York (SDNY). TransparentBusiness Inc., the development company behind the Unicoin project, has filed a lawsuit against Universal Navigation Inc., the parent entity operating Uniswap Labs.

The legal action directly targets Uniswap’s intellectual property assets. In its court filing, Unicoin asked the U.S. federal court to cancel the registration of the “UNI” trademark held by Uniswap Labs. The move comes just weeks before Unicoin’s public launch of its UNCN token, scheduled for September 28.

Demands to Surrender Domains

Unicoin’s lawsuit comes in response to mounting pressure over the past three months. Before the dispute reached the court, Uniswap’s legal team had sent three consecutive cease-and-desist letters, dated June 3, July 17, and August 14, 2026.

In those warning letters, Uniswap accused Unicoin of trademark infringement, trademark dilution, cybersquatting, and unfair competition within the crypto industry. Based on these allegations, Uniswap issued a series of demands for damages to its competitor.

They urged Unicoin to immediately cease using all derivative trademarks containing the word “UNI”. Uniswap also demanded the handover of two primary domains owned by the developer, namely unicoin.com and unicoin.org. These demands were accompanied by requests for Unicoin to disclose its revenue and operating profit reports, as well as reimburse all legal fees incurred by Uniswap.

Clarity on Trademark Status

Faced with ongoing legal pressure, TransparentBusiness Inc. took the battle to court. In addition to requesting the federal cancellation of the “UNI” trademark, they urged the judge to issue a declaratory judgment that the UNICOIN trademark does not infringe upon Uniswap Labs’ intellectual property rights.

Unicoin asked the court to confirm that its product names do not dilute or infringe on the UNI, UNISWAP, and UNICHAIN trademarks held by Uniswap. The case involves the dominant platform in the decentralized exchange (DEX) sector. According to DeFiLlama data at the time of the filing, the Uniswap protocol led global DEX volume with 24-hour transactions exceeding $3.9 billion. The fight to protect market dominance must now proceed alongside the trademark dispute in a New York courtroom.
